Artificial Intelligence (AI) is the intelligence demonstrated by machines, in comparison to the usual intelligence demonstrated by human beings and animals. Machine learning (ML), which is a primary concept of AI research from its inception, is a branch that involves algorithms that improve themselves automatically through learning and exp. There are three types of ML algorithms based on broad classification. They are Supervised Learning, Unsupervised Learning and Reinforcement Learning. In Semi-Supervised Learning model, Input data may or may not have targets. The model must learn the organization and structure of the data to make predictions and it is similar to a prediction problem. Regression is the process of estimating the association among variables that are iteratively developed with reference to error calculations prevalent in the model. In instance-based learning method, the predictors that are considered to be significant or mandatory to the model for decision making are taken into account.